Surgical ultrasonic harmonic shear QUHS14S 23S 36S 45S for vessel sealing and dissection

Introduction:

The surgical ultrasonic harmonic shear QUHS14S 23S 36S 45S is a surgical device for vessel sealing and dissection simultaneously in different surgery. Unlike Electrosurgery, the harmonic surgical shear use ultrasonic vibrations instead of electric current to do the sealing and dissection acction. Usually it work together with handpiece and generator.

Advantage:

Harmonic scalpel or ultrasonic shear which has advantage as below:

1. Ergonomic handle grip design: redices fatigue, stabilizes operation
2. Minimal thermal spread: tip of scalpel with special coating which can reduce the tissue sticking, and cause the smallest eschar and desiccation on the tissue.
3. Precise dissection and reliable hemostasis
